ABOUT SCAG
Over the past four decades, the Southern California Association of
Governments (SCAG) has evolved as the largest of nearly 700 councils of
government in the United States, functioning as the Metropolitan
Planning Organization (MPO) for six counties: Los Angeles, Orange, San
Bernardino, Riverside, Ventura and Imperial.
As the designated MPO, SCAG is mandated by the federal government to
research and put together plans for transportation, growth management,
hazardous waste management, and air quality.

B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F PROJECT
SCAG is seeking a qualified vendor to provide SCAG with a street
centerline file and other related geographic files such as census tract
boundaries, jurisdiction boundaries, zip code boundaries, hydrographic
layers, cultural features and associated software. The software/data is
crucial to SCAG's goal of being the central source of data/information
for and about the Southern California region.
